0

これらの文章と単語を「titluri.txt」という名前のテキストファイルに書き込んでいます。この「titluri.txt」には次のものがあります。

「word1word2calculatorulnu porneste din cauza ca @コンピュータが起動しない理由#」

私はこのphpスクリプトを使用します:

..etc etc $ fisier1 = fopen( "titluri.txt"、 "r"); while((!feof($ fisier1))&&($ citeste = fscanf($ fisier1、 "%s \ t%s \ t%[^ @] s \ t%[^#] s \ n"))){

list($ baza_de_date、$ tablou、$ subiect、$ subiect_en)=$citeste;}など。

しかし、なぜ$subiect_enが効果がないのか理解できません。テキストファイルから読み取ると「word1」が表示され、「word2」が表示され、「calculatorul nu porneste din cauza ca」という文が表示されますが、「コンピュータが起動しないため」がどこにもありません。

4

1 に答える 1

0

これを試して"%s\t%s\t%[^\t]%[^#\n]"

于 2013-02-23T00:12:34.923 に答える